The Role

The Oncology Key Account Manager will play a pivotal role in establishing Genmab in Italy with accountability for building and maintaining strong relationships with key stakeholders, including hospitals, specialist cancer centers, academic medical institutions, and oncology professionals across Italy. This individual will be responsible for promoting Genmab’s oncology portfolio, with a focus on solid tumors and gynecologic oncology, to healthcare professionals and key decision-makers.

The KAM will be responsible for driving product adoption and ensuring optimal regional and local access across assigned territories. The role requires a strong blend of scientific engagement, account management, stakeholder partnership, and market access capabilities. The successful candidate will work cross-functionally to identify opportunities, remove barriers to access, and deliver value to healthcare professionals, institutions, and patients.

Regional and Local Market Access

  • Drive regional and local access initiatives to ensure timely product availability and uptake following national reimbursement.
  • Map and engage key stakeholders involved in access decision-making, including regional payers, hospital administrators, pharmacy directors, procurement teams, and healthcare authorities.
  • Support inclusion of the product in regional formularies, therapeutic pathways, and hospital protocols.
  • Monitor regional funding mechanisms, procurement processes, and access barriers, developing tailored action plans to address them.
  • Collaborate closely with Market Access, Medical Affairs, and Government Affairs colleagues to implement regional strategies.

About Genmab

Genmab is an international biotechnology company with a core purpose to improve the lives of patients through innovative and differentiated antibody therapeutics. For 25 years, its hard-working, innovative and collaborative team has invented next-generation antibody technology platforms and harnessed translational, quantitative and data sciences, resulting in a proprietary pipeline including bispecific T-cell engagers, antibody-drug conjugates, next-generation immune checkpoint modulators and effector function-enhanced antibodies. By 2030, Genmab’s vision is to transform the lives of people with cancer and other serious diseases with Knock-Your-Socks-Off (KYSO®) antibody medicines.

Established in 1999, Genmab is headquartered in Copenhagen, Denmark with international presence across North America, Europe and Asia Pacific. For more information, please visit Genmab.com and follow us on LinkedIn and X .
